Output 621b3dbfa00725e96d634e756bcee2925cc01e2adcaf8525e7ce0517361549e2:3

value
19588868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7da8009d3ac8a83d253e364083abd2542056e35f OP_EQUAL
address
MKMZxRLDtwXmF1pkJ9eqosqb6nmjPfmXrB
transaction
621b3dbfa00725e96d634e756bcee2925cc01e2adcaf8525e7ce0517361549e2
spent
true